web前端工程师主要做什么的
-
Web前端工程师主要负责网页前端开发工作。他们负责将设计师提供的网页设计稿转化为可交互的网页界面,同时确保界面的优化、性能的提升和用户体验的改善。
具体来说,Web前端工程师主要做以下几方面的工作:
-
HTML/CSS编码:Web前端工程师使用HTML和CSS来完成网页的结构和样式的定义。他们需要将设计师提供的设计稿转化为HTML代码,通过CSS进行样式的定义和布局。
-
JavaScript开发:Web前端工程师需要使用JavaScript来实现网页的交互功能,例如表单验证、菜单展示、页面动画等。他们需要掌握JavaScript的语法和常用的库和框架,例如jQuery、React、Vue等。
-
响应式设计和移动端适配:随着移动互联网的发展,Web前端工程师需要保证网页在不同尺寸的设备上能够有良好的显示效果。他们需要使用响应式设计的技术和技巧,确保网页在各种设备上都能够适配。
-
浏览器兼容性处理:不同的浏览器对网页的解析和显示效果可能存在差异,Web前端工程师需要处理这些兼容性问题,确保网页在各种主流浏览器上都能够正常运行。
-
性能优化和SEO优化:Web前端工程师需要关注网页的性能,包括加载速度、响应时间等方面的优化。他们还需要了解SEO(搜索引擎优化)的基本原理,通过合理的网页结构和标签使用来提升网页在搜索引擎中的排名。
-
与后端开发人员的协作:Web前端工程师需要与后端开发人员进行紧密的协作,实现前后端数据的交互和页面的动态更新。他们需要了解HTTP协议和后端开发的基本原理,以便更好地与后端开发人员进行沟通和协作。
总之,Web前端工程师是负责网页前端开发的专业人员,他们需要精通HTML/CSS/JavaScript等前端技术,同时具备良好的设计和交互能力,以及与团队协作和沟通的能力。通过不断学习和实践,他们能够为用户提供更好的网页体验。
1年前 -
-
作为一个Web前端工程师,主要负责开发和维护网站的前端部分。以下是Web前端工程师的五个主要职责:
-
页面开发:Web前端工程师负责将网站的设计图转化为实际可交互的网页。他们使用HTML、CSS和JavaScript等技术来创建和排版网页内容,确保页面在不同浏览器和设备上的兼容性。
-
网站优化:Web前端工程师负责优化网站的性能和速度。他们通过压缩CSS和JavaScript文件、优化图片和使用浏览器缓存等技术提高网站的加载速度,以提升用户体验。
-
用户界面设计:Web前端工程师与UI设计师密切合作,开发各种用户界面元素,如按钮、表单、导航菜单等。他们确保用户界面的可用性和易用性,并根据用户反馈和需求进行调整和改进。
-
浏览器兼容性测试:Web前端工程师负责确保网站在各种主流浏览器上正常运行。他们会进行不同浏览器的兼容性测试,修复可能出现的bug和兼容性问题,以提供一致的用户体验。
-
与后端开发人员的协作:Web前端工程师与后端开发人员密切合作,确保前端和后端的无缝集成。他们需要了解后端技术(如PHP、Java、Python等),并与后端开发人员沟通和协调,实现网站的功能和交互效果。
综上所述,Web前端工程师负责将网站设计转化为可交互的网页,优化网站性能,设计用户界面,进行浏览器兼容性测试,并与后端开发人员协作,以创建出功能完善、用户友好的网站。
1年前 -
-
Web前端工程师主要负责开发Web页面和应用程序的用户界面。他们与设计师和后端开发人员密切合作,确保网站的外观和功能都能够达到预期目标。以下是Web前端工程师的主要工作内容:
-
分析需求和设计界面:与项目经理、产品经理、设计师等一起分析项目需求,理解用户需求和设计要求,根据需求设计用户界面。
-
切图和页面重构:根据设计师提供的UI设计图,利用HTML和CSS等前端技术将设计图切分成各个网页元素,并进行页面重构。这包括确定网页的布局结构、样式和交互效果。
-
编写前端代码:使用HTML、CSS和JavaScript等技术编写前端代码,实现页面的静态展示和动态交互。前端工程师需要熟悉各种前端开发框架和库,如React、Vue等,以及HTML5和CSS3等新技术。
-
网页优化和性能优化:通过压缩CSS和JavaScript文件、优化图片和减少HTTP请求等方式,提高网页的加载速度和浏览器的渲染效果,提升用户体验。
-
兼容性测试和调试:在不同浏览器和设备上测试和调试网页,解决兼容性问题,确保网页能够在各种环境下正常运行。
-
与后端开发人员合作:与后端开发人员进行接口对接,实现前后端的数据交互和处理,确保前端页面与后端数据的正确对接。
-
网页安全性和用户体验优化:关注网页的安全性和用户体验,加入合适的安全机制和用户反馈功能,提高用户对网页的信任度和满意度。
-
持续学习和技术研究:关注前端领域的最新技术和发展动态,学习和研究新技术和工具,不断提升自己的技术能力。
以上是Web前端工程师的主要工作内容,他们在开发过程中需要兼顾网页的功能、性能、安全性和用户体验,同时与项目团队成员紧密协作,共同完成项目的开发工作。
1年前 -